#e530c5 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#e530c5 is composed of 89.8% red, 18.8% green and 77.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 79% magenta, 14%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 310.6 degrees, a saturation of 77.7% and a lightness of 54.3%. #e530c5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ff60ff with #cb008b.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

● #e530c5 color description : Bright magenta.
The hexadecimal color #e530c5 has RGB values of R:229, G:48, B:197 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.79, Y:0.14,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15020229.
